What is the meaning of irreverence?
1 : lack of reverence. 2 : an irreverent act or utterance.Likewise, people ask, what does irreverence meaning in English?: having or showing a lack of respect for someone or something that is usually treated with respect : treating someone or something in a way that is not serious or respectful. What is MIS tool?
In business, management information systems (or information management systems) are tools used to support processes, operations, intelligence, and IT. MIS tools move data and manage information. Read More →How are evaporators being useful in food industry?
Evaporators are widely used in the food processing industry to remove a portion of the water from food products. Read More →What is PDA in mobile phones?
Short for personal digital assistant, a handheld device that combines computing, telephone/fax, Internet and networking features.
